
J44W法兰角式截止阀的启闭件是塞形的阀瓣,密封面呈平面或锥面,阀瓣沿流体的中心线作直线运动。阀杆的运动形式,(通用名称:暗杆),也有升降旋转杆式,(通用名称:明杆)截止阀是指关闭件(阀瓣)沿阀座中心线移动的阀门。根据阀瓣的这种移动形式,阀座通口的变化是与阀瓣行程成正比例关系。由于该类阀门的阀杆开启或关闭行程相对较短,而且具有非常稳定的切断功能,又由于阀座通口的变化与阀瓣的行程成正比例关系,非常适合于对流量的调节。因此法兰角式截止阀非常适合作为切断或调节以及节流用。
J44W法兰角式截止阀性能范围:
| 型号 | 公称压力 | 试验压力 | 工作温度 (℃) | 适用介质 | ||
| 强度(水) | 密封(水) 空气(Mpa) | 低压密封 空气(Mpa) | ||||
| J44W-16P® | 1.6 | 2.4 | 1.8 | 0.6 | ≤200 | NITRIC ACID |
| 硝酸类 | ||||||
| J44W-25P® | 2.5 | 3.8 | 2.8 | 0.6 | ≤200 | ACETIC ACID |
| 醋酸类 | ||||||
| J44W-40P® | 4.0 | 6.0 | 4.4 | 0.6 | ≤200 | NITRIC ACID |
| 硝酸类 | ||||||
J44W法兰角式截止阀主要零件材料:
| 零件名称 | 材料 |
| 阀体、阀盖 | Cf8、CF3、CF8M、CF3M |
| 阀瓣 | 304、304L、316、316L |
| 阀杆 | 304、304L、316、316L |
| 阀杆螺母 | 铝铁青铜 Al bronze |
| 手轮 | 灰铸铁、可锻铸铁 |

法兰角式截止阀
法兰角式截止阀是一种进出口通道成90°直角、阀瓣与阀座密封面与水平面呈一定角度的特殊截止阀。它通过法兰与管道连接,结合了角式阀体的流动特性与法兰连接的稳固性,适用于流向改变和空间受限的工况。
法兰角式截止阀核心特点:
角式阀体设计:流体在阀内实现90°的方向改变,减少了不必要的弯头管件,降低了管道阻力和应力,简化了管道布局。
法兰连接:阀体两端带有标准法兰,通过螺栓与管道法兰紧固。连接强度高,密封稳定,便于拆卸和维护,适用于中高压工况。
流阻低于直通式:由于流道直接转弯,相比直通式截止阀,其对流体的阻碍更小,压力损失有所降低。
法兰角式截止阀自排空能力:当介质为液体时,阀门关闭后阀腔内不易积存液体,便于排空和防止冻结,尤其适合蒸汽和易结晶介质。
密封性好:继承了截止阀密封面不易磨损、密封性能好的优点。
法兰角式截止阀主要应用领域:
蒸汽系统(锅炉蒸汽出口、蒸汽减压站、疏水阀前)
易结晶、高粘度及含颗粒介质管道
炼油、化工装置中需要改变流向的工艺管道
火力发电厂汽水系统

Flanged Angle Globe Valve - Product Overview
A Flanged Angle Globe Valve is a specialized type of globe valve with an inlet outlet port oriented at a 90-degree angle to each other. The disc seat are designed to align with this flow path. It utilizes flanged ends for connection, combining the benefits of the angle pattern for flow direction change with the strength reliability of a flanged joint.
Key Features:
Angle Body Design: The fluid changes direction by 90° within the valve body itself, eliminating the need for an additional pipe elbow. This reduces system pressure drop, minimizes pipe stress, simplifies piping layout.
Flanged Connection: Standard flanges on both ends allow for a robust, leak-proof connection to the piping via bolts. This facilitates easy disassembly for maintenance is suitable for medium to high-pressure services.
Lower Flow Resistance: Compared to a standard straight-through (T-pattern) globe valve, the angle design offers a more streamlined path for the changing flow, resulting in reduced flow resistance pressure drop.
Self-Draining Capability: When closed, the valve cavity does trap liquid, making it ideal for steam services (prevents water hammer) for handling fluids that may crystallize solidify.
Excellent Shut-Off: Inherits the reliable, tight sealing capability characteristic of globe valves, with minimal wear on the seat disc.
Primary Applications:
Steam systems (e.g., boiler steam outlet, pressure reducing stations, upstream of steam traps)
Pipelines handling crystallizing, viscous, slurry media
Process piping in refineries chemical plants a flow direction change is required
Power plant feedwater steam systems
